It seems like photos and info on upcoming models always leaks out, somehow. This time the first official photos of the 2012 BMW M5 have leaked onto the internet ahead of its official unveiling.
Thanks to the M5 Concept and the numerous spy photos of the M5 prototypes testing all over the world, these official photos do not contain anything surprising. The 2012 M5 looks basically the same as the lesser powered 5 Series, with the exception of the larger air intakes in the front fascia, 20-inch wheels and four tailpipes out back.
The previous M5 got its motivation from a V10 engine, but the newest model is powered by a twin-turbocharged 4.4L V8 with 552 horsepower and 501 lb-ft. of torque. Its expected to reach 0-60 mph in 4.4 seconds.
